Reply to Suslov
Published 2001-06-01Version 1
In a recent submission to this archive arXiv:cond-mat/0105325, Suslov has claimed that our recent numerical estimate of the critical exponent of the Anderson transition $\nu=1.57\pm.02$ is in error and that the available numerical data are consistent with a value of $\nu=1$. We contest this claim and demonstrate using Suslov's own scaling procedure that $\nu\ne 1$
